What Is a Recessed LED Panel Light? Core Concepts
A led panel light recessed solution delivers thin, even light that sits flush with your ceiling. Unlike bulky fixtures of the past, these sleek panels create a “window to light” effect that transforms any space.
Edge-lit panels work like a high-tech magic trick – LEDs positioned around the edges feed light into a specially engineered light guide plate that spreads illumination evenly across the entire surface. Backlit panels take a more straightforward approach, placing LEDs directly behind a diffuser panel. This design typically costs less while delivering impressive light output.
What really sets these fixtures apart is their ability to work in shallow plenum spaces – those cramped areas above drop ceilings where traditional fixtures simply won’t fit. With profiles as thin as 10-11mm, they slip into spaces that would make a standard can light weep with envy.
The beam uniformity is where LED panels really shine. Instead of harsh hot spots and deep shadows created by point-source lights, quality panels deliver consistent illumination from corner to corner. High-end models achieve Color Rendering Index (CRI) values of 90-98, which means colors look natural and appealing under artificial light.
Modern panels also feature flicker-free drivers and smooth dimming capabilities. The constant current drivers maintain stable brightness and color temperature throughout the fixture’s decades-long life, while advanced dimming protocols like 0-10V integrate seamlessly with smart building systems.

How Recessed Panels Differ From Other Fixtures
Can lights are the old workhorses – those cylindrical fixtures that create focused beams but can turn your living room into a landscape of harsh shadows. Fluorescent troffers are those rectangular office fixtures that make everyone look slightly green and tired. Surface-mount disk lights sit on top of your ceiling like lighting pancakes, lacking the integrated elegance of recessed panels. Pendant luminaires hang down from the ceiling, creating visual drama but eating up precious headroom.

Types, Shapes, and Technical Specs of a led panel light recessed solution
When you’re shopping for LED panels, understanding the basics makes choosing the right led panel light recessed solution much easier.
Most panels follow standard ceiling grid dimensions. The 1×4 foot panels work beautifully for linear applications, 2×2 foot squares are the workhorses of modular layouts, and 2×4 foot rectangles give you maximum coverage with fewer fixtures.
Round panels offer a different aesthetic. Available in diameters from 4 inches up to 24 inches or larger, they’re especially popular in homes where the softer circular form feels more natural than sharp rectangles.
The edge-lit versus backlit choice affects both your wallet and lighting quality. Edge-lit panels use LEDs around the perimeter with precision light guide plates, creating incredibly uniform illumination and ultra-thin profiles as slim as 10mm. They typically cost more due to sophisticated optics. Backlit panels place LEDs directly behind a diffuser panel – they’re usually more affordable and can deliver higher lumens per watt.
Wattage options range from 6W accent panels up to 80W units. Quality panels deliver 120-140 lumens per watt or higher, translating directly into lower electric bills.
Color temperature flexibility includes warm white (2700-3500K) for cozy residential spaces, neutral white (4000-4500K) for offices, and cool white (5000-6500K) for areas needing sharp focus. Tunable white panels can adjust across this entire range.
High CRI ratings of 90+ ensure colors look natural. For retail or galleries where color accuracy is crucial, specialty panels achieve CRI values of 95-98. Don’t overlook IP ratings for moisture resistance – bathrooms and covered outdoor areas need IP54-IP65 rated panels.

Selecting Specs for Your Space
Getting specs right starts with understanding light requirements. Office lighting typically requires 30-50 foot-candles, while retail spaces might need 50-100 foot-candles. For residential applications, we recommend 10-20 foot-candles for general living areas, but kitchens need 30-75 foot-candles and home offices should have 50+ foot-candles.
Here’s a practical starting point: figure on 1.5-2.5 watts per square foot for general lighting in spaces with 8-10 foot ceilings. Driver type affects dimming compatibility – 0-10V drivers work with commercial systems, while TRIAC dimmers are standard for residential. Look for UL or ETL safety listings, DLC qualification for utility rebates, and Energy Star certification for residential projects.
Key Metrics That Define a High-Performance led panel light recessed solution
Efficacy of 120 lumens per watt or higher indicates serious long-term energy savings. Color Rendering Index (CRI) of 90 or higher ensures natural-looking colors. L70 life ratings exceeding 50,000 hours mean decades of reliable service. Total Harmonic Distortion (THD) below 15% prevents electronics interference, while Power Factor (PF) above 0.9 indicates efficient power usage and code compliance.

Common Installation Methods
Suspended grid installation is the easiest method if you have a drop ceiling. Quality panels come with spring-loaded clips that grab T-bar rails automatically. Just pop out the old tile, make electrical connections, and drop the panel into place.
Sheet-rock recess creates the cleanest look but requires precision. You’ll need to cut an exact opening and use provided mounting clips. The ultra-thin profile makes this possible even without much space above the ceiling.
Surface mounting works when cutting into ceiling isn’t practical. The surface-mount frame sits slightly proud of the ceiling, but with today’s slim panels, the difference is barely noticeable.
Cable-hung installations open up creative possibilities for high ceilings or when you want the panel to float at a specific height.
Avoiding Glare, Shadows & Harshness
Layered lighting design prevents that sterile feeling. Your LED panels provide the foundation, but add table lamps or wall sconces for visual interest and flexibility.
Color temperature choice dramatically affects how your space feels. Warm white around 2700K creates cozy residential atmosphere. Cool white at 5000K+ can feel clinical without balancing elements. For most applications, neutral white between 3500-4000K hits the sweet spot.
Dimming capability transforms any space from functional to comfortable. Modern LED panels dim smoothly without flicker or color shift.

Maintenance & Troubleshooting
Quality LED panels require minimal maintenance. Regular dusting with a soft cloth keeps panels performing at their best. Driver replacement becomes the main maintenance task as panels age – quality panels use plug-in drivers that swap out easily. IP-rated cleaning for bathroom and kitchen panels requires attention to edge seals. Keep warranty documentation – most quality panels come with 5-year warranties. Flicker testing with your smartphone camera can identify failing drivers before they affect everyone.

Future Trends & Innovations in Recessed LED Panel Lighting
The future of led panel light recessed solution technology is incredibly exciting. After watching this industry evolve for three decades, we’re on the edge of game-changing innovations.
Micro-LED arrays promise to push efficiency beyond 200 lumens per watt while delivering color rendering virtually indistinguishable from natural sunlight. Manufacturing costs are dropping fast as production scales up.
Power over Ethernet (PoE) integration is already happening in forward-thinking commercial projects. Instead of separate electrical circuits, these panels get both power and control through standard network cables, simplifying installation dramatically.
Circadian tuning goes beyond basic color temperature adjustment. These systems automatically shift light characteristics throughout the day to support your body’s natural rhythms – gradually warming in evening to help you wind down, cooling in morning for alertness.
IoT integration makes LED panels part of smart building ecosystems. Panels that learn preferences, adjust based on occupancy and weather, and communicate with other building systems. Your lighting could coordinate with HVAC systems to optimize comfort and efficiency.
Sustainability drives major changes in materials and manufacturing. Recycled aluminum housings are becoming standard, manufacturers are developing bio-based diffuser materials, and improved end-of-life recycling programs ensure panels don’t end up in landfills.

What color temperature is best for offices versus homes?
Office lighting is about finding the productivity sweet spot. We recommend 4000K neutral white for most commercial spaces – not too warm, not too cool, but just right for computer work and reading. It gives crisp visibility without harsh, clinical feeling.
Tunable white panels are becoming our go-to for forward-thinking offices. These can deliver energizing cool white (5000-6500K) during morning and afternoon work sessions, then shift to warmer 3000-3500K for meetings or after-hours activities.
Home lighting tells a different story. We recommend warm white (2700-3000K) for most residential spaces – living rooms, bedrooms, dining areas where you want that cozy feeling. Kitchens and home offices can handle slightly cooler 3500-4000K for detailed tasks, but we keep it warmer than commercial spaces because home should feel like home.
How much energy can I save compared to fluorescent fixtures?
Most clients see lighting energy bills drop by 50-60% immediately after switching to a led panel light recessed solution. A typical 2×4 fluorescent troffer burns about 64 watts with ballast losses. The LED panel replacement? Just 25-35 watts for the same or more light.
Over the 50,000-hour lifespan of quality LED panels, you’re looking at $400-600 in energy savings per fixture. For a 100-fixture office, that’s enough savings to pay for the entire retrofit within 2-3 years. The real kicker is maintenance savings – no more burnt-out tubes, flickering lights, or ballast failures.
Can I retrofit existing can lights with slim panel kits?
Absolutely, and it’s one of our most popular services. Ultra-thin wafer panels designed for retrofits can transform old, harsh can lights into smooth, even illumination. The process is straightforward for standard 6-inch cans – we connect the new panel to existing electrical and use spring clips to secure it flush.
4-inch cans are trickier and limit options somewhat. For best results, we often recommend removing old cans entirely and installing proper mounting hardware. Yes, it’s more work upfront, but the finished look is cleaner and you get the full range of panel options.
